David Ball is farm manager for Kemble Farms Ltd. In 2008 they completed the installation of a 300kW anaerobic digestion plant, which complemented their dairy unit and provided another income following fluctuating milk prices. The plant was limited to this size by its locality to National Grid connections. For example, if they went above 300kW at its current location, they would require three miles of additional cabling. While generating electricity and making economic sense, the plant is also producing additional benefits for the environment and local residents.
